Creator 3in1 31170 Wild Animals – Pink Flamingo [Review, featuring all 3 builds]

This has been a bumper year for Creator 3in1: Over the past decade, we have seen between 13 and 17 sets (including polybags) released over the course of the year. Here we are at the beginning of March, and that count is already up to 12. We typically see a few sets released around midyear, so I wonder if we will be edging a little higher than average this year.

One thing that has characterised the sets that we have looked at so far this year (31162, 31163,61165) has been the emphasis on organic-looking creature builds, with a limited primary colour palette: we have seen quarter circle curved slope elements emphasised in medium stone grey, tan, and black.

The 31170 Wild Animals Pink Flamingo broadens this palette further with the addition of these curved elements in vibrant coral and a great collection of light purple elements.The box demonstrates 3 models: the titular Flamingo, an axolotl and a galah – a pink parrot renowned for wreaking havoc on both the local landscape and soundscapes here in Australia.

Creator 3in1 31165 Wild Animals Panda Family (All Forms)

LEGO® Creator 3 in1 is going in for creature modeling in a big way in 2025, with six of the nine new sets featuring creatures, real or imagined. The LEGO Group have sent a few of these sets over for review. (all opinions are my own)

Today, I’d like to look at 31165 Wild Animals: Panda Family. With 626 pieces, and priced at $AUD59.99 / $USD39.99/ €39.99/ £34.99. the set brings us builds with the theme of animal families – featuring an adult and its young. Here the builds include Pandas; Orca and Penguins. Lets take a closer look.
